About this clinic

California Shockwave, a regenerative physical-medicine clinic in Pleasanton, specializes in Shockwave Therapy for chronic musculoskeletal pain, joint conditions, and soft-tissue injuries. The practice combines shockwave treatment with chiropractic care, physical therapy, and trigger-point intervention to address pain without relying on pharmaceuticals or surgery. Shockwave therapy uses acoustic-energy pulses to stimulate tissue repair and reduce inflammation, making it suitable for tendinopathy, plantar fasciitis, and other conditions resistant to conventional conservative care. I'd heard of Shockwave for kidney stones, but wasn't sure how it would work on my painful shoulder. Would I have to sit in a tub of water like the kidney stone treatments, or would the Shockwave therapy give me the curly hair that mother nature had denied me? I liked the idea of a non-invasive treatment (in a dry environment). The pain was up to a 7, and was interfering with my sleep. Even sleeping on my back or other side was painful. Some days I couldn't pick up a mug of coffee. I walk with a cane in my right hand, so walking became difficult. After 3 visits the pain had decreased to a 5, but I had to have a non-related surgery, so I restarted therapy several weeks later and have now completed 6 therapy sessions after the restart. I still don't have curly hair, but my shoulder pain is almost gone, and I can even sleep on my right side again!   The office staff have been pleasant and friendly, and work with me to schedule my appointments that avoid rush-hour traffic.  Thanks, Dr. Rodriguez!

I have felt a lot of improvement in my right foot pain. I have plantar fiscitas, stress fracture and a cyst in my right foot. I tried many therapies like physiotherapy, cast, massage, cortisone shots, expensive insoles but nothing helped me much. It was hard to walk inside my home even. I tried shockwave therapy with Dr.Abraham which gave me much relief. It took me 6 visits to feel the difference but I feel much better now and I have recently started going back to gym. I would highly recommend this therapy to anyone who is struggling with chronic pain. Dr. Abraham is a very talented physician who can clear your doubts by explaining in depth and giving you options to choose from. I am happy to have him as a pain relief provider and am looking forward to start Shockwave therapy for my lower back pain as well.
